Georgian honey export halved in 2023

Georgian natural honey export has soared by 1631.5% in the last 5 years, as per Sakstat data. However, in January-December 2023, it declined by 57.2% compared to the same period of 2022.

Export of Georgian natural honey by years:

2019- 6.38t

2020- 21.71t

2021- 172.92t

2022- 258.18t

2023- 110.47t

According to the data of recent years, Bulgaria and France are the leading exporting countries. In 2021-2023, our country exported 210.62 tons of honey to Bulgaria, 204 tons to France.

The top three exporting countries in the last 5 years are:

2019

United Arab Emirates — 1.92t

Germany- 1.90t

Japan- 0.55t

2020

Italy — 10.09t

USA- 4.89t

Bulgaria – 2.83 tons

2021

Bulgaria – 76.44 tons

France – 65.40 tons

Russia – 10.00t

2022

Bulgaria – 112.25 tons

France – 97.2 tons

Norway – 21.0 tons

2023

France- 41.40 tons

Bulgaria – 21.93 tons

Iraq – 13.25 tons
